    "headline": "Infinix Note 50 Pro Racing Edition vs Xiaomi Poco X8 Power",
    "answer": "The Xiaomi Poco X8 Power is the stronger phone of the two, scoring 86 against 81 on our combined specification score. It leads on camera, battery & charging and memory & storage. The Infinix Note 50 Pro Racing Edition still wins on value for money, so it remains the better choice if that is your priority. The Infinix Note 50 Pro Racing Edition is the cheaper of the two at PKR 89,999 against PKR 99,999.",

        {
            "question": "Which phone has the better battery, Infinix Note 50 Pro Racing Edition or Xiaomi Poco X8 Power?",
            "answer": "Xiaomi Poco X8 Power leads on battery. Infinix Note 50 Pro Racing Edition carries a 5200 mAh cell and Xiaomi Poco X8 Power a 10000 mAh cell, with 90W and 100W wired charging respectively."
